Job Description

This role is a business development role in the VCS team, helping to grow the procurement and Travel & Entertainment (T&E) business in UK & Ireland and Continental Europe. The aim of this role is to support Visa account executives and sales managers to grow their portfolios of purchasing and T&E transactions. This will include helping Issuers develop strategies for addressing business to business Procurement opportunities & expanding capabilities to address T&E; directly supporting Issuers with key deals and opportunities and, manage new Visa partners in the procurement environment that support growth.

What we expect of you, day to day.

  • This is a business development role in Visa Commercia Solutions (VCS) that focusses on building use of the Visa network and Visa commercial products for procurement and T&E use cases, leveraging Visa Purchasing and T&E products and related products in their physical, virtual and mobile formats. This is primarily a role focussing large market and middle market.
  • Develop an understanding of the range of solutions that Visa has available to address this opportunity. These solutions can include Visa network capability and those delivered by partners, in particular collaborating with acquirers. This includes the suite and mobile solutions under Visa Commercial Pay.
  • Work with the wider VCS team to build an understanding of the technology environment around procurement and payment in Europe, e.g. ERP system providers, procurement networks, and other new Fintechs that focus on procurement, payment optimisation or receivables processing as well as the products and eco system for T&E. Build relationships with these organisations and work with the partnerships team where appropriate to create referral or reseller partnership opportunities.
  • Use this knowledge and these skills to be a highly experienced, confident, expert and consultative member of the VCS team, working with Issuers and their customers. Be able to identify procurement challenges, design the best payment solutions working with Product and Solution sales teams, using Visa products, and manage these opportunities through to implementation. As well as being able to identify T&E payment pain points and address how our suite of products can solve for them. These opportunities may be anywhere in UK & I or Continental Europe and will cross many types of industry segments.
  • To be effective, an understanding of the payment services used by buyers to pay suppliers, including existing account to account services, (both domestic and cross border) and the cost and benefits of these. An understanding of new request-to-pay and Open Banking models and the ability to relate those to buyer/supplier transactions will be important, as will an understanding of the rapidly growing B2B marketplace environment.As well as having a good understanding of the business travel eco system, including payment methods utlised.
